Breaded Pork Steaks with Potato Salad

March 31, 2016April 5, 2020 ~ jarmilascooking ~ 5 Comments

This is another classic dish that seems to be rooted in our history and geographical position in Central Europe. Having been part of the Austro-Hungarian Empire from 1867 to 1918 and sharing the southern border with Austria since then, we have borrowed a few cooking techniques and ideas from the Austrians as well. Awards

A Taste of Slovakia is proud to wear The Best in the World title from Gourmand International. The book came second in the Eastern Europe Category at the Gourmand World Cookbook Awards 2018 in Yantai, China.
